|
幽冥传奇技能的解说,可以做个参考 [backcolor=var(--local-bg-color)]build\LogicServer\data\config\skill\skillData 文件夹内 --战士-刺杀" t. Y7 }$ z/ Q. q- Z* `( _0 `6 }
{" U w( |( O7 C7 O1 }% {7 ?
id = 1,--技能的ID: O. K8 X" E2 _; w" o$ |
name = Lang.Skill.s1Name,--技能名称* Y, T$ W: G. J0 z# l9 }
desc = Lang.Skill.s1Desc,--技能描述/ K) ~+ l) l1 y: s2 g" P5 J
vocation = 1,--职业,0通用,1战士,2法师,3道士
, c+ _6 n* ? f4 t0 @ isDelete = false,--是否废弃,如果废弃了用true,否则用false! ]4 f- T' L2 U; u
skillType = 0,--技能的类型(从技能的功能上划分,物理、魔法、毒物主要用于区分命中、闪避),0表示物理攻击,1被动,2魔法攻击,3,毒物攻击,4表示生活技能,5其他特殊技能(比如光环类)
: t" Z7 L9 ~# c: d, _/ w* g- N+ K skillClass = 1,--技能的分类(从系统上做区分的技能的分类),1玩家职业基本技能,2玩家通用技能(所有人都能学),3宠物技能(道士宝宝),4怪物技能,5必杀技,6,挖矿技能,7,结拜技能,8,开门技能(沙巴克城门),9 英雄技能 10 赛马技能 ,11 喷泉技能
5 M4 P$ ?/ d* u, T/ _8 P7 q skillSpellType = 0, --0表示直接释放,如果选择了目标将直接释放
! ]' K% P3 L* V- T: C6 ` --1表示点击了技能图标以后,还需要选择一个目标才会释放% Q0 ?) |5 m" D. C5 N1 i
--2表示点击技能图标以后,在鼠标位置释放,(类似法师的火墙术),方向是当前与鼠标的方向) F, l# @. z; @1 @
--3 表示仅对自己使用,这时将忽略选中的目标,上发的坐标是当前面向的1格的坐标,方向上发的面向的方向4 @& z/ l2 m) }- Y7 M8 }4 F
--4 直接释放(类似战士的野蛮冲撞,坐标是当前玩家的坐标,朝向是当前玩家的朝向,目标发个0)
$ y0 z5 \2 i$ c/ k commonCd = 300,--使用的时候触发的公共的cd时间,单位是毫秒3 ^8 g7 `" M0 o3 q5 z% U
delayCd = 0,--cd时间延迟检测,长CD技能使用,优化大招因延迟原因使用失败,却进入冷却带来的影响,一般填500ms* T4 i6 E6 B% T0 c' S
canbeDefault = true,--是否作为默认技能,不填写就是false2 J( `/ E+ E& |2 O: T. [% U
specialBuffCond = 0,--封是封内功,断是断外功8 n" A; t1 F8 M' q
--技能在特殊的buff的下是否能够使用& E! C7 L: p0 J" W, T
--0表示在封断和晕眩都不能使用,默认是0
1 Z( W; g/ V7 |. b --1表示在封断的时候能够使用
# F, J9 N* U3 R( K* k3 d --2表示在晕眩的时候能够使用
4 q1 z* s# c8 X+ V$ M --3表示在晕眩和封断的时候都能使用9 C: G# _2 M' Y' j* q4 ^
notAutoUse = false,--挂机时不自动使用,默认都是false0 }' U% W+ @4 C- j- N0 ]: H- W! k
magicLock = false,--是否支持魔法锁定,默认是false,只有配置了true,魔法锁定才能有效# h8 \/ h' Z* M5 y8 W
needCalPassiveProperty = false,--是否需要计算被动属性,某些主动技能也需要按被动技能计算属性
& U7 X. y% ~ o8 A6 K% Z8 w4 @) `' g5 o priority = 0,--技能的优先级,优先级高的在同等条件下放
- Z* F3 l: u$ A/ e5 a8 k( Z maxLevel = 20,--技能最大等级,必须配置,如果没有上限就配置个超级大的数值。
# L' a/ @7 t; ] skillSubLevel = {' a& Y1 N: x% x' Z8 a. y- I
--技能的各等级的信息4 w. ]/ a$ U% ?' p% s& W S- S
--#include "Skill_1_1.lua") A* o! _3 U3 U
--#include "Skill_1_2.lua"( T8 s; M* e: n h: s
--#include "Skill_1_3.lua" + e; i5 @1 b% I' Z* X1 x
--#include "Skill_1_4.lua" G% C- K7 \6 p9 r$ P& H* Q9 R
--#include "Skill_1_5.lua"
: m( U: w+ o' c: V6 S# Z--#include "Skill_1_6.lua" . {1 m: }! _ E$ l- G+ d" G$ d
--#include "Skill_1_7.lua"
5 J! Y8 Y7 Y6 }7 M4 C. t6 V. a--#include "Skill_1_8.lua" , G. R$ d5 y. a+ t3 W
--#include "Skill_1_9.lua" 3 ~$ U( n/ @2 ~. O1 ?( @2 ?
--#include "Skill_1_10.lua"
/ |) P/ n/ |9 P9 y--#include "Skill_1_11.lua"( ?/ j) c- n4 n4 I
--#include "Skill_1_12.lua"% i* J( s! B4 O9 f7 t
--#include "Skill_1_13.lua" . K9 ^% E4 H' B
--#include "Skill_1_14.lua"
+ R5 a: @. c( r6 P$ Y--#include "Skill_1_15.lua"
F; P8 t, x4 U' v, L1 t# u--#include "Skill_1_16.lua" , c# J: R6 w; n7 o P
--#include "Skill_1_17.lua" # V6 h- r" o& M% F: q& y
--#include "Skill_1_18.lua"
7 A: P$ Q. t' E) w% r--#include "Skill_1_19.lua" & h7 m/ Y2 V2 W$ H2 N6 R
--#include "Skill_1_20.lua"
. S7 E* T; g/ T, ~) u& [ },
* W# Y+ ?2 e) o2 R0 ]},
. l6 y) l' D! W
$ Z* [8 ?- C9 D |
|